
Carrots Vichy
Appetizers • French
Description
If possible, choose young and thin carrots for better flavor. To make this recipe successful, it is not necessary to use Vichy water or sparkling water. I use regular still bottled water. You can try cooking with different types of water. Some add parsley during cooking, while others add cumin just before serving. Thanks to this recipe, children love to eat carrots. It is important that the carrots caramelize at the end of cooking. They can be served hot or cold with meat or fish.

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1
Wash and peel the carrots.
Step 2
Slice them into thin rings.
Step 3
In a large pot, place the carrots, butter, sugar, salt, and pour in enough water to slightly cover the carrots, then heat over medium heat.
Step 4
Cover with a lid and monitor the process. After about 40 minutes, the water will evaporate.
Step 5
It is important that the carrots do not burn at all. The carrots should be melt-in-your-mouth tender.
Step 6
However, at the very end, you can leave the carrots on the heat for a few more minutes until they are slightly browned, stirring with a wooden spoon.
